By Cynthia Johnston and Frederik Richter
MANAMA, Feb 19 (Reuters) - Protesters in Bahrain took back a symbolic square on Saturday and Libyan security forces shot more people demonstrating against longtime leader Muammar Gaddafi as uprisings sweeping the Arab world challenged its rulers.
The anti-government demonstrators in Bahrain swarmed into Pearl Square in Manama, putting riot police to flight in a striking victory for their cause and confidently setting up camp for a protracted stay.
